Course Goal / Objective
Teaching acquisition, analyzing , interpreting and making decisions of hydrologic and meteorological data.Helps students to interpret the study results according to these principles
Course Content
Hydrologic cycle; hydro-meteorological data; evapotranspiration; ground waters; prediction of runoff and flow with various methods; analysis of hydrograph, flood routing, statistical methods in hydrology with simple applications.

Week Plan
| Week | Topic | Preparation | Methods |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Definition, importance, branches and history of Hydrology. | Power point presentations Pages 1-13 | |
| 2 | Meteorological data | Power point presentations Pages 14-22 | |
| 3 | Evapotranspiration | Power point presentations Pages 23-63 | |
| 4 | Rainfall, its occurunce and measurement. Interpretation and analysis of rainfall data. Double mass curve, thiessen poligons and isohips. | Power point presentations Pages 64-88 | |
| 5 | Interpretation and analysis of rainfall data. | Power point presentations Pages 89-114 | |
| 6 | Snow ,properties and melting amount | Power point presentations Pages 115-124 | |
| 7 | Infiltration | Power point presentations Pages 125-150 | |
| 8 | Midterm exam | Preparation for Midterm Exam | |
| 9 | Groundwater ,types of aquifers,descriptions related with groundwater,hydraulics of wells | Power point presentations Pages 151-182 | |
| 10 | Surface water, measurement of flow and velocity | Power point presentations Pages 183-227 | |
| 11 | Analysis of hydrograph, unit hydrograph | Power point presentations Pages 228-246 | |
| 12 | S hydrograph | Power point presentations Pages 247-253 | |
| 13 | Synthetic hydrograph | Power point presentations Pages 254-270 | |
| 14 | SCS method, Rasyonel and Mc Math methods | Power point presentations Pages 271-293 | |
| 15 | Probability and statistics in Hydrology | Power point presentations Pages 313-350 | |
